Solution for 2(4n-1)=3(2n+5) equation:


Simplifying
2(4n + -1) = 3(2n + 5)

Reorder the terms:
2(-1 + 4n) = 3(2n + 5)
(-1 * 2 + 4n * 2) = 3(2n + 5)
(-2 + 8n) = 3(2n + 5)

Reorder the terms:
-2 + 8n = 3(5 + 2n)
-2 + 8n = (5 * 3 + 2n * 3)
-2 + 8n = (15 + 6n)

Solving
-2 + 8n = 15 + 6n

Solving for variable 'n'.

Move all terms containing n to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-6n' to each side of the equation.
-2 + 8n + -6n = 15 + 6n + -6n

Combine like terms: 8n + -6n = 2n
-2 + 2n = 15 + 6n + -6n

Combine like terms: 6n + -6n = 0
-2 + 2n = 15 + 0
-2 + 2n = 15

Add '2' to each side of the equation.
-2 + 2 + 2n = 15 + 2

Combine like terms: -2 + 2 = 0
0 + 2n = 15 + 2
2n = 15 + 2

Combine like terms: 15 + 2 = 17
2n = 17

Divide each side by '2'.
n = 8.5

Simplifying
n = 8.5
